Output 58bba24bc6902af66ffe1ef387627226e6e622be81fc3e316cdb4f06d982c98e:0

value
422562
script pubkey
OP_0 OP_PUSHBYTES_20 adeaa6f377090ece59dae10f0a4bb5ee0f262b81
address
bc1q4h42dumhpy8vukw6uy8s5ja4ac8jv2up6nz39h
transaction
58bba24bc6902af66ffe1ef387627226e6e622be81fc3e316cdb4f06d982c98e
spent
true